    As a simple blacksmith's daughter, Briannith has always dreamed of Lords and Ladies. Even more so, she dreams of knights in shining armor, that she had no part in making. She tries to spend all of her free time around the castle in hopes of catching the eyes of some honorable man in the capitol. Her father always laughs, strikes his hammer on hot steel, and tells her to stop living in the clouds and pick a suitable match already so he needn't be bothered with her. Not that that would be hard for Briannith; she is far from ugly and could easily marry a blacksmith with much more future than her father. But that wouldn't be good enough. She and her best friend vowed that they would run away to Steden and find a noble knight to wed and bed. She has just arrived with little more than the clothes on her back. Little does she know that status does not make a man truly honorable. Barely able to afford living, she thought she might have to sacrifice everything and join a brothel. But right before she entered one, a handsome man came up to her. He introduced himself as a member of House Pheme. With her innocence, she was worth so much more than her body. If she promised to help him, he could give her the key to everything she ever wanted. Now she is training to be a spy in court and mingle with the country's best and brightest, whether she realizes it or not.
